Thousands of people are quite willing to be saved by Christ, but when it comes to the
very first step, namely, that Jesus must be accepted as ruler, lawgiver, master, king,
and Lord, then they start back and reject eternal life. 1375.535
You must either let him reign over you, or else you will have to lie beneath his feet. 2940.297
I cannot conceive it possible for anyone truly to receive Christ as Saviour and yet not
to receive him as Lord. One of the first instincts of a redeemed soul is to fall at the
feet of the Saviour, and gratefully and adoringly to cry, “Blessed Master, bought with
thy precious blood, I own that I am thine,—thine only, thine wholly, thine for ever.
Lord, what wilt thou have me to do?” 3229.617
It is not possible for us to accept Christ as our Saviour unless he also becomes our
King, for a very large part of salvation consists in our being saved from sin’s
domination over us, and the only way in which we can be delivered from the mastery
of Satan is by becoming subject to the mastery of Christ. 3229.617
